Some sectionals are convertible. This means that they can be set up to fit your space, whether it is an L-shaped design or a chaise design. When you purchase a reversible sectional make sure you know whether you want the chaise to be on the right or left side of the sofa when you are facing it directly. To determine this consider standing in front of the sectional and looking at it. If the arm of the 3 seater chaise lounge is on your right, you should choose an armchair with a right-arm facing (RAF) chaise. If the chaise's arm is on your left pick a chaise with a left-arm facing sectional.

You might be confused by the terminology used in the field when you are looking for a new sectional. This sectional sofa guide will clarify the various terms and features you should be aware of.
This kind of sectional is perfect for small spaces, as it makes use of the corner space. It's also flexible and can be used as a entertainment space or bedroom, or even a home office. Certain models can be transformed into beds for guests.
Modular sectional: The components of this kind of sectional are "sections" that can be put together to form an even larger sofa. It's a great option for those who enjoy the idea of moving around their furniture.
Reversible chaise - This type of sectional allows you to move the chaise to either side of the couch. This is a great option when you want to alter the layout of your room or make the chaise an occasional bed for guests.
